Stories for a Starry NightPresented by Buehler Planetarium and Observatory at Buehler Planetarium and Observatory April 11-June 27, 2012 This hour-long live presentation uses our digital planetarium theater to educate and entertain people by presenting them with stories and information about the objects that are currently visible in our evening sky, like bright stars, planets, and constellations. As each season shares a different slice of the heavens above, visitors should come back periodically to discover all the wonders of our Florida skies. | Buehler Planetarium and Observatory | 04/11/12- 06/27/12 | Fort Lauderdale |

The King and IPresented by Lake Worth Playhouse at Lake Worth Playhouse October 4-October 21, 2012 In this romantic musical, the boy-meets-girl plot is woven into the historical context of the British Imperialism in Asia. It is also the story of a clash between cultures and the dynamics between Great Britain and The Orient.
The King of Siam invites an English governess to come to his country and teach the children of his many wives about the modern world. Barum The MusicalPresented by Lake Worth Playhouse at Lake Worth Playhouse April 11-April 28, 2013 The show traces the life of the legendary huckster Phineas Taylor Barnum from the purchase of his first sideshow act through his partnership with James A. Bailey.
At the center is the stormy but loving relationship between P.T. and his wife, Charity who attempts to tame her wild husband. He finally convinces her but curtain’s close that the world desperately needs his particular brand of hogwash. | Lake Worth Playhouse | 04/11/13- 04/28/13 | Lake Worth |
